WebMar 7, 2024 · Insulated glazing comprises two glass panes that help lower heat entering or leaving a room. This feature is beneficial in keeping a house cool in summers and warm in winters, reducing the use of air conditioners or heaters, respectively. Hence, it minimises the consumption of electricity.
